boxyhq/jackson
Transform enterprise authentication with this powerful solution that bridges SAML login to OAuth 2.0/OpenID Connect and enables automated user management through SCIM 2.0 directory sync.
Open source alternatives to:
Enterprise Authentication Made Simple
SAML Jackson revolutionizes enterprise authentication by seamlessly bridging SAML login flows with OAuth 2.0 and OpenID Connect protocols. This innovative solution abstracts away the complexities of SAML implementation while providing robust directory synchronization capabilities through SCIM 2.0.
Streamlined Authentication Integration
At its core, SAML Jackson serves as an intelligent proxy that transforms traditional SAML authentication into modern OAuth 2.0 and OpenID Connect workflows. This transformation eliminates the need for developers to wrestle with SAML's intricate protocols, allowing them to focus on building their core application features instead of authentication infrastructure.
Advanced Directory Synchronization
The platform's directory sync functionality, powered by SCIM 2.0, delivers automated user lifecycle management that streamlines organizational workflows. This powerful feature enables:
- Automated user provisioning and deprovisioning
- Centralized user identity management
- Enhanced data security through synchronized access control
- Reduced administrative overhead
Key Features and Benefits
SAML Jackson stands out with its comprehensive feature set designed to meet enterprise security needs:
- Seamless SAML to OAuth/OIDC conversion
- Support for both Service Provider (SP) and Identity Provider (IdP) initiated flows
- Built-in admin portal for connection management
- Flexible deployment options (separate service or NPM library)
- OpenID Connect provider support
- Enterprise-grade security standards
Enterprise-Ready Security
Security is paramount in SAML Jackson's design, incorporating:
- Advanced observability through OpenTelemetry integration
- Comprehensive SBOM (Software Bill of Materials) reporting
- Container signing and verification capabilities
- Regular security updates and vulnerability management
Deployment Flexibility
SAML Jackson adapts to your infrastructure needs with multiple deployment options:
- Standalone service deployment with built-in admin portal
- NPM library integration for embedded functionality
- Cloud deployment support for major providers
- Docker container availability for containerized environments
Technical Excellence
The platform maintains high technical standards through:
- Comprehensive API documentation with Swagger support
- Extensive end-to-end testing capabilities
- Active maintenance and regular updates
- Strong community support and contribution framework
SAML Jackson represents a significant advancement in enterprise authentication, offering a robust, secure, and developer-friendly solution for organizations seeking to modernize their authentication infrastructure while maintaining enterprise-grade security standards.